Marry Me Cookies Ingredients
For the Cookie Base
• Unsalted Butter – Provides rich flavor and tenderness; ensure it’s softened for easy creaming.
• Granulated Sugar – Adds sweetness that helps create a crisp texture.
• Brown Sugar – Increases moisture and depth of flavor; can be substituted with coconut sugar for a richer taste.
• Large Eggs – Binds the ingredients and aids in rising.
• Vanilla Extract – Enhances the cookie’s overall flavor; can replace with almond extract for a unique twist.
• All-Purpose Flour – Forms the structure of these Marry Me Cookies; gluten-free flour can be a substitute.
• Baking Soda – Acts as a leavening agent, ensuring the cookies rise perfectly; make sure it’s fresh.
• Salt – Balances sweetness; consider sea salt when sprinkling for that finishing touch.
For the Mix-Ins
• Chocolate Chips – Adds sweet, creamy texture; can swap for white chocolate or peanut butter chips to mix things up.
• Chopped Nuts (optional) – Introduces a lovely crunch; omit or replace with seeds if you prefer a nut-free cookie.
For the Finishing Touch
• Sea Salt (for sprinkling) – Elevates the sweetness with a hint of salinity; skip if you’re avoiding salt altogether.
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Marry Me Cookies
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C) to ensure it’s ready for baking your Marry Me Cookies. While the oven heats, line your baking sheets with parchment paper, which will prevent the cookies from sticking and make cleanup easy.
Step 2: Cream the Butters and Sugars
In a large mixing bowl, cream together 1 cup of softened unsalted butter, 1/2 cup of granulated sugar, and 1 cup of brown sugar using an electric mixer. Beat on medium speed for about 3-5 minutes until the mixture is light and fluffy, creating the perfect base for these irresistibly soft cookies.
Step 3: Add the Eggs and Vanilla
Next, gradually add 2 large eggs, one at a time, mixing well after each addition to fully incorporate them into the batter. Follow this by stirring in 2 teaspoons of vanilla extract, which will enhance the flavor of your Marry Me Cookies and infuse them with warmth and sweetness.
Step 4: Combine Dry Ingredients
In a separate bowl, whisk together 2 ¾ cups of all-purpose flour, 1 teaspoon of baking soda, and ½ teaspoon of salt. This combination will provide the structure your cookies need. Once whisked, g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, ensuring to mix until just combined—be careful not to overmix, as it can affect the texture.
Step 5: Fold in the Chocolate Chips
Now it’s time to fold in 1 ½ cups of chocolate chips and any chopped nuts you desire. Use a spatula to gently incorporate these mix-ins until evenly distributed throughout the dough, creating delightful bursts of flavor in every bite of your Marry Me Cookies.
Step 6: Scoop the Cookie Dough
Using a rounded tablespoon or a cookie scoop, drop rounded balls of dough onto your prepared baking sheets, leaving approximately 2 inches of space between each. This spacing will allow the cookies to spread while baking, resulting in perfectly shaped Marry Me Cookies with crisp edges and gooey centers.
Step 7: Sprinkle with Sea Salt
Before they head into the oven, sprinkle each dough ball with a pinch of sea salt. This final touch not only enhances the sweetness but adds a lovely contrast that takes your Marry Me Cookies to the next level.
Step 8: Bake the Cookies
Slide the baking sheets into your preheated oven and bake for 10-12 minutes. Keep a close eye on them; the edges should turn golden brown while the centers remain slightly underbaked, achieving the perfect chewy texture that makes these cookies so irresistible.
Step 9: Cool and Transfer
Once baked, allow the cookies to cool on the baking sheet for about 5 minutes. This resting period helps them finish setting up. Afterward, carefully transfer the cookies to a wire rack to cool completely, ensuring they maintain their soft and chewy centers.

How to Store and Freeze Marry Me Cookies
Room Temperature: Store cooled c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 1 week to maintain their soft texture and freshness.
Fridge: If you prefer, you can refrigerate the cookies in an airtight container for up to 2 weeks, though this may slightly alter their texture.
Freezer: For longer storage, freeze cookies in a single layer on a baking sheet, then transfer to a freezer-safe container for up to 3 months.
Reheating: To enjoy the cookies warm, reheat in a microwave for 10-15 seconds or in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 5 minutes until warmed through.
Marry Me Cookies Variations & Substitutions
Feel free to get creative and put your own spin on these Marry Me Cookies to make them uniquely yours!
- Dairy-Free: Use coconut oil instead of butter, and swap in dairy-free chocolate chips for a rich dairy-free version.
- Gluten-Free: Substitute all-purpose flour with a 1:1 gluten-free flour blend to accommodate gluten sensitivities without sacrificing flavor.
- Nut-Free: Omit nuts and replace them with seeds like sunflower or pumpkin seeds for a delightful crunch without nuts.
- Flavor Twist: Add a teaspoon of espresso powder or instant coffee to the dough for an energizing mocha flavor that complements the chocolate beautifully.
- Fruity Addition: Incorporate ½ cup of chopped dried fruits, such as cranberries or apricots, for a sweet twist that adds a burst of flavor in every bite.
- Add Some Spice: Sprinkle in a teaspoon of cinnamon or pumpkin spice for a warm and cozy flavor profile—perfect for the fall season.
- Mini Cookie Version: Scoop smaller balls of dough to create bite-sized cookies, which are perfect for sharing or serving at parties.

Expert Tips for Marry Me Cookies
-
Use Room Temperature Butter: Ensure your unsalted butter is softened to room temperature; this helps in achieving a light and fluffy cookie dough.
-
Avoid Overmixing: When combining dry ingredients with wet, mix just until incorporated to keep your Marry Me Cookies tender and soft.
-
Chill Sticky Dough: If your cookie dough feels too sticky, chill it in the refrigerator for 10-15 minutes before scooping to make handling easier.
-
Measure Flour Correctly: Spoon flour into your measuring cup and level it off to avoid packing it down, which can lead to dry cookies.
-
Check Baking Time: Keep a close eye on your cookies as they bake; remove them from the oven when the edges are golden but the centers look slightly underbaked for that perfect chewy texture.
Make Ahead Options
These Marry Me Cookies are a dream come true for busy home cooks looking for a time-saving treat! You can prepare the cookie dough up to 24 hours in advance; simply cover it tightly with plastic wrap and refrigerate it. This method not only allows the flavors to meld beautifully but also prevents the dough from spreading too much while baking. When you’re ready to bake, just scoop the dough onto your baking sheets and sprinkle with sea salt before popping them in the oven. If you want to prep even further ahead, you can freeze the shaped dough balls for up to 3 months. Just bake them straight from the freezer, adding a couple of extra minutes to the baking time.
